10.—(1) Following the service of a notice under Article 5, the Department may by notice declare the establishment of a zone to be known as a “temporary control zone”.
(2) The location and size of the temporary control zone in any case shall be such as the Department considers necessary to prevent the spread of disease.
(3) Where a temporary control zone has been established, a person shall not –
(a)move any pig off a holding, slaughterhouse or knacker’s yard in the zone except in accordance with a licence issued by an inspector acting in accordance with the directions of a veterinary inspector;
(b)move any cattle, sheep, goat, or other ruminating animal off any holding, slaughterhouse or knacker’s yard in the zone which has pigs in it except in accordance with a licence issued by an inspector acting in accordance with the directions of a veterinary inspector; or
(c)move any pig out of the zone.
(4) The prohibition in paragraph (3)(c) shall not apply to pigs which are loaded onto a vehicle outside the zone and transported through it without the vehicle being loaded or unloaded.
(5) When a controlled area has been established which touches the border with Northern Ireland the Department may, as it considers necessary, establish such an associated temporary control zone in Northern Ireland for the purposes referred to in paragraph (2).
(6) Any holding, slaughterhouse or knacker’s yard which is partly inside and partly outside a temporary control zone shall be deemed to be wholly inside that zone.
(7) In this Article “controlled area” means any area declared as such in the Republic of Ireland for preventing or controlling the spread of the disease.
(8) Nothing in paragraph (6) shall deem any area outside Northern Ireland to be inside a temporary control zone.
